About this property

Rainhill Hall

4-star hotel in Rainhill
There's a restaurant on site. You can enjoy a drink at the bar/lounge. WiFi is free in public spaces. Self parking is free.

This 4-star Liverpool hotel is smoke free.

  • 42 guestrooms or units
  • Breakfast available (surcharge)
  • Front desk (limited hours)
  • Storage area for luggage
  • Concierge
  • No smoking on site
  • Bar or lounge
  • Dining venue
Rainhill Hall offers 42 accommodations with coffee/tea makers and hair dryers. Each accommodation is individually furnished and decorated. 40-inch Smart televisions come with digital channels.

This Liverpool h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access. Additionally, rooms include irons/ironing boards and complimentary toiletries. Housekeeping is provided on request.

8/10 Good

Phil

Travelled with partner
Liked: Cleanliness, staff & service
Nice hotel, friendly staff. Converted retreat centre, so doesn't entirely feel like a hotel. Stayed in the presidential sweet with twin baths which are fun. Big TV. Decor a little gauche but a nice room none-the-less. No hot water in shower in morning which was a shame. Also we could hear every conversation at the reception downstairs and the live music in the restaurant. Live music finished at 930 which was a reasonable time. But did need music on the Tele to mask the conversation from reception. The onsite restaurant was reasonably priced (two steak dinners, with starters, two bottles of wine, and breakfast for around £130. Portions were generous and nicely presented. Menu is small but they have focused on doing less really well. Really Well! The live music was unexpected at first but grew on us! Nice hotel but a few finishing touches like bathrobes, more towels than the minimum two, shower gel, products for use in the bath, and a fabric chaise longue rather than vinyl would have genuinely made it feel like a luxury stay. It was a fun nice stay, but not quite the luxury anticipated from the pictures. Restaurant was best feature, and would possibly visit the restaurant again but not the hotel.
